Gallium Arsenide (GaAs) is widely used in electronic devices due to its high electron mobility and direct bandgap. It is commonly used in high-frequency amplifiers, microwave circuits, and RF switches. GaAs is also used in solar cells and detectors, as it has a high absorption coefficient for sunlight. In light-emission devices, GaAs is employed in LEDs and laser diodes. GaAs diodes are used in various applications, including radar systems, telecommunications, and medical devices. GaAs wafers are high-purity, single-crystalline substrates used in the production of electronic devices like lasers and solar cells. GaAs PIN diodes are semiconductor devices with a structure that allows for controlled current flow, commonly used in RF and microwave applications.
